About the Property

Oméga Residence, Rouen is a contemporary, purpose-built student housing option located at 9, Rue Duguay Trouin, Rouen, 76000, France. Designed to support independent student living, Oméga Residence offers spacious studio apartments in a secure and community-focused environment. This well-managed Oméga Residence student accommodation is ideal for students who value privacy while still enjoying shared social spaces.

Oméga Residence accommodation for students is conveniently positioned close to key academic institutions. The closest university is Université de Rouen Normandie – Pasteur Campus, located approximately 1.8 km away. This distance equals around 6 minutes by car, 9 minutes by bike, or 15–18 minutes by public transport, making daily travel easy and reliable. Features

Oméga Residence provides fully self-contained studio apartments designed to meet modern student needs. These studios reflect the quality and comfort associated with Oméga Residence furnished rooms, offering functional layouts that support both academic and everyday living.

Each Oméga Residence studio apartment ranges from 20 to 34 sqm and is located across the ground floor, first floor, and fourth floor. Every studio includes a private bathroom and private kitchen, ensuring complete independence. Room amenities include a bed, desk area, and an equipped kitchen, making the space practical and comfortable for daily routines.

Residents enjoy inclusive living with bills included, covering hot and cold water, heating, unlimited high-speed Wi-Fi, common charges, and a furnished apartment with a linen kit provided. A wide selection of Oméga Residence amenities enhances student life, including a chill zone, coworking area, shared kitchen for socialising and studying, appliance loan service, 24/7 laundry room, break & fast kit, disposable linen kit with duvet cover and pillowcase, dishware kit provided before arrival, flat-screen TV rental service, and a fitness zone. Guarantor Requirement
<p>The property requires you to have a guarantor.</p> <p><br></p> <p>Note:</p> <p>1. A guarantor must be a financially solvent French tax resident.</p> <p>2. The guarantor must prove an income approximately three times the rent amount.</p> <p>3. If a student does not have a guarantor in France, the residence manager or the property team can assist in finding a suitable solution.</p>

What is an inventory report and what is it for?

The inventory report is a document prepared between the resident and the property. It is completed when the resident moves in and again upon departure. Issued in several copies and given to each party, it must be kept throughout the rental period. The move-in inventory is carried out on the day the keys are handed over (not necessarily on the day of signing the lease). It records the condition of the unit when the resident moves in. When moving out, the inventory report describes the condition of the apartment at the end of the lease. It confirms that residents who have maintained their unit return it in good condition to the property.

What documents are required for housing assistance applications?

When applying for housing assistance, you’ll need to provide the following documents:
  • A copy of your ID
  • Proof of your student status
  • Proof of income, or if you have none, a sworn statement confirming you received no income in the previous year
  • Your bank account details (RIB) if you want the assistance to be paid directly to you
  • Your CAF beneficiary number, if you already have one
Tips: Like many administrative procedures, processing by CAF takes time. They recommend preparing your application as early as possible to start receiving assistance quickly. Note: The first month of your lease is considered a “waiting month” – housing assistance is not granted or paid during this period. Housing assistance is paid in arrears (e.g., assistance for September rent is paid in early October), starting from the 1st day of the month following the date you meet all conditions. Example: If you move in on September 25, you’ll be eligible for assistance starting October 1, paid in early November.

What is the procedure for leaving my apartment?

If you wish to leave your apartment before the end of your lease, you must send your notice respecting the legal notice period (1 month from receipt of the notice):
  • By registered mail with acknowledgment of receipt to the address of your residence
  • By handing it directly to your residence manager You will then receive confirmation of receipt of your request.

How long does it take to get my security deposit back?

The legal timeframe for refunding the security deposit is one month from the end date of the notice period (if the exit inventory matches the entry inventory). If charges apply, the refund may take up to two months.

Best Areas to Live in Rouen

Rouen offers a mix of lively historic districts and quieter residential neighbourhoods, making it easy for students to find an area that fits their lifestyle and budget. With a compact layout, good public transport, and a strong student population, the city provides several student-friendly options close to universities and everyday amenities. Here are some of the best areas to live in Rouen for students:

1. Centre-Ville: The city center is one of the most popular areas for students who want to be close to everything. Known for its medieval streets, half-timbered houses, cafés, restaurants, shops, libraries, and cultural venues, it offers a lively atmosphere and excellent walkability. With easy access to buses and nearby university buildings, the city centre is ideal for students who enjoy an active social and cultural life.

2. Saint-Sever: Located just south of the Seine, Saint-Sever is a well-connected and practical neighbourhood popular with students. The area features affordable housing, supermarkets, a large shopping centre, and reliable bus and metro links. Its proximity to the city centre and university campuses makes it a convenient option for daily commuting.

3. Mont-Saint-Aignan: Mont-Saint-Aignan is a major student hub and home to several university campuses. It is especially popular with students studying science, technology, and engineering. The area offers student residences, affordable apartments, green spaces, sports facilities, and direct transport links to central Rouen.

4. Jardin des Plantes / Saint-Clément: This quieter residential area appeals to students looking for a more peaceful living environment. Close to green spaces like the Jardin des Plantes, the neighbourhood offers affordable rent, local shops, and good public transport connections. It suits students who prefer calm surroundings while remaining well connected to the city centre and universities.

Student Travel in Rouen

In Rouen, getting around the city is simple, efficient, and well-suited to student life. As a compact and walkable city with a reliable public transport network, Rouen allows students to commute easily between university campuses, residential neighbourhoods, and social areas. Discounted student passes and short travel distances help keep daily travel affordable. Here’s an overview of the main transportation options available to students living in student accommodation in Rouen:

1. Tram, Metro & Bus (Astuce): Rouen’s public transport is operated by the Astuce network and includes tram lines, a metro system, and an extensive bus network. These services connect key student areas such as the city centre, Mont-Saint-Aignan university campus, Saint-Sever, and residential neighbourhoods. A single ticket costs around €1.60–€1.80, while discounted monthly student passes offer unlimited travel across the network.

2. Trains (T1 & T3): Rouen train station provides strong regional and national rail connections. Students can travel to Paris in around 1.5 hours, as well as to other Normandy cities such as Le Havre and Caen. Regional TER services make Rouen a convenient base for internships, weekend trips, and academic travel.

3. Cycling & Walking: Rouen is a walkable and increasingly bike-friendly city, especially around the historic centre and riverside areas. Dedicated cycling lanes and paths along the Seine River make cycling a popular and eco-friendly option for students. Many students also prefer walking for daily travel due to the city’s compact layout.

Student Lifestyle and Tourist Attractions in Rouen

Rouen offers a rich and well-balanced student lifestyle that blends medieval charm with a lively cultural scene. With a strong student population, the city feels youthful, social, and welcoming, making it easy for students to settle in and feel connected. Many students spend their time around the historic city centre, Rue du Gros-Horloge, and Place du Vieux-Marché, where cafés, bakeries, bookstores, and casual restaurants double as study spots and social hangouts.

The Seine riverbanks are especially popular for walking, cycling, and relaxing with friends, offering calm outdoor spaces right near the city centre. For quieter moments, students often visit Jardin des Plantes, one of Rouen’s most loved green spaces, ideal for picnics, reading, jogging, or study breaks between classes. Rouen is rich in culture and tourist attractions that students explore throughout the year. Highlights include the Cathédrale Notre-Dame de Rouen, famously painted by Monet, the Gros-Horloge, and the half-timbered houses lining the old town streets.

Sites linked to Joan of Arc, such as the Historial Jeanne d’Arc, add historical depth to everyday city life. Museums, theatres, exhibitions, and seasonal events keep the cultural calendar active, while local markets and festivals bring energy to the streets.
